PETRO-CANADA
Closed
Advertisement
Arthur St S
Woolwich, ON N3B
A Suncor Energy business, Petro-Canada is Canada’s Gas Station with a network of more than 1,500 retail and wholesale outlets across Canada.
See a problem?
You might also like
Partial Data by Foursquare.
Advertisement
